Analyzing the play script alongside the TV pilot reveals the brilliance of Waller-Bridge’s adaptation process. The play's structure is episodic and stream-of-consciousness, fitting for a 65-minute solo performance. When moving to the screen, the script had to expand to accommodate visual storytelling and interpersonal dynamics. However, the "camera look" in the TV show is the direct descendant of the play’s stage directions. The script’s requirement for Fleabag to constantly check in with the audience translates perfectly into the cinematic language of the series, maintaining that sense of complicity. Conclusion
